    Box office. $6,158 [1] 12 Feet Deep (originally titled The Deep End) [2] is a 2017 American psychological horror - thriller film written and directed by Matt Eskandari. It stars Alexandra Park and Nora-Jane Noone as sisters who find themselves trapped inside a public swimming pool when the manager activates the pool cover and leaves for the ...
